The MGS/MDT pool and filesystem were created using these commands:

zpool create -f -o ashift=12 -O canmount=off lustre-mgs-mdt
mirror /dev/disk/by-path/pci-0000:00:1f.2-scsi-0:0:0:0 /dev/disk/by-path/pci-0000:
00:1f.2-scsi-1:0:0:0

mkfs.lustre --mgs --mdt --fsname=iconfs --backfstype=zfs --dev
ice-size 131072 --index=0 lustre-mgs-mdt/mgsmdt0

However, now the MDT is full, and 8 OSTs are 86% full.

lustre-mgs-mdt/mgsmdt0
                        73G   73G     0 100% /mnt/lustre/local/mgsmdt
lustre-ost0/ost0       13T   11T  1.8T  86% /mnt/lustre/local/ost0


Is there a way to clear space, or will the filesystem/MDT need rebuilt?

Previously, the same disks were used for creating a mirrored MDT w/o
-ashift=12, and did not fill up even when the OSTs were at 89%.
Thanks for any advice.
